In little less than a decade brain slices have gained prominence among neurobiologists as appropriate tools to study cellular electrophysiolog ical aspects of mammalian brain function. The Appendix, "Brain Slice Methods," is a multiauthored treatment of the technical aspects of brain slice work, collected into one document.
